The Strand
Beach
The Strand is a seaside foreshore located in Townsville, Australia. It is located in the suburb of North Ward. The Strand has a view of the Port of Townsville and Magnetic Island, as well as to Cape Cleveland. The Strand is situated 1¼ km southeast of Dingo and Curlew.
Townsville Sports Reserve
Sports venue
Townsville Sports Precinct is a multi-use sports precinct located in Townsville, Australia. With redevelopments completed in early 2022, the venue now offers three indoor multipurpose courts, multiple fields and athletics facilities with a main stadium capacity of 4000 spectators. Castle Hill
Peak
Photo: Hanek45, Public domain.
Castle Hill is a heritage-listed isolated pink granite monolith in the suburb of Castle Hill, City of Townsville, Queensland, Australia. Its Indigenous name is Cootharinga, sometimes written as Cooderinga.
